商城首页欢迎来到中国正版软件门户

最新文章

  • 带参数的全类型 Python 装饰器 正版软件
    带参数的全类型 Python 装饰器
    这篇短文中显示的代码取自我的小型开源项目按合同设计,它提供了一个类型化的装饰器。装饰器是一个非常有用的概念,你肯定会在网上找到很多关于它们的介绍。简单说,它们允许在每次调用装饰函数时(之前和之后)执行代码。通过这种方式,你可以修改函数参数或返回值、测量执行时间、添加日志记录、执行执行时类型检查等等。请注意,装饰器也可以为类编写,提供另一种元编程方法(例如在attrs包中完成)在最简单的形式中,装饰器的定义类似于以下代码:defmy_first_decorator(func):defwrapp
    1071天前 Python 装饰器 0
  • Redis如何实现延迟队列 正版软件
    Redis如何实现延迟队列
    使用依赖配置4.0.0org.springframework.bootspring-boot-starter-parent2.3.12.RELEASEcom.homeeyredis-delay-queue0.0.1-SNAPSHOTredis-delay-queueredis-delay-queue1.8org.springframework.bootspring-boot-starter-data-redisorg.springframework.bootspring-boot-starter-webo
    1071天前 redis 0
  • Java的注解Annotaton怎么用 正版软件
    Java的注解Annotaton怎么用
    1、三种基本的Annotaton@Override:限定某个方法,是重写父类方法,该注解只能用于方法@Deprecated:用于表示某个程序元素(类,方法等)已过时@SuppressWarnings:抑制编译器警告@Overrideclassfather{publicvoidfly(){}}classsonextendsfather{@Overridepublicvoidfly(){super.fly();}}解读@Override表示son重写了fly方法细节如果没有@Override还是会重写fly方
    1071天前 Java 0
  • MySql多级菜单查询怎么实现 正版软件
    MySql多级菜单查询怎么实现
    背景工作中(尤其是传统项目中)经常遇到这种需要,就是树形结构的查询(多级查询),常见的场景有:组织架构(用户部门)查询和多级菜单查询比如,菜单分为三级,一级菜单、二级菜单、三级菜单,要求用户按树形结构把各级菜单查询出来。如下图所示对于层级固定,层级数少的,一般3级,需求实现很简单,先查询最小子级,再依次查询上级,最后再组装返回给前端就是了。那么问题来了,如果层级数很大,10级,或者干脆层级不确定,有的3级,有的5级,有的8级,与之前的层级固定,层级数相比,显然问题更复杂了,我们来看看这种怎么处理三级查询(
    1071天前 MySQL 0
  • 怎么使用Python制作一个数据大屏 正版软件
    怎么使用Python制作一个数据大屏
    PywebIO介绍Python当中的PywebIO模块可以帮助开发者在不具备HTML和JavaScript的情况下也能够迅速构建Web应用或者是基于浏览器的GUI应用,PywebIO还可以和一些常用的可视化模块联用,制作成一个可视化大屏。我们先来安装好需要用到的模块。pipinstallpywebiopipinstallcutecharts上面提到的cutecharts模块是Python当中的手绘风格的可视化神器,相信大家对此并不陌生,我们来看一下它与PywebIO模块结合绘制图表的效果是什么样的,代码如
    1071天前 Python 0
  • MySQL中replace into与replace区别是什么 正版软件
    MySQL中replace into与replace区别是什么
    0.故事的背景【表格结构】CREATETABLE`xtp_algo_white_list`(`strategy_type`intDEFAULTNULL,`user_name`varchar(64)COLLATEutf8_binDEFAULTNULL,`status`intDEFAULTNULL,`destroy_at`datetimeDEFAULTNULL,`created_at`datetimeDEFAULTCURRENT_TIMESTAMP,`updated_at`datetimeDEFAULTCUR
    1071天前 MySQL replace replace into 0
  • MySQL怎么去除字符串中的括号及括号里的所有内容 正版软件
    MySQL怎么去除字符串中的括号及括号里的所有内容
    去除字符串中的括号以及括号里的所有内容update表set列名=REPLACE(列名,SUBSTRING(列名,LOCATE('(',列名),LOCATE(')',列名)),被替换的字符)用到的函数replace(列名,被替换的字符串,替换后的字符串):替换字符串中的一部分内容substring(列名,开始位置,结束位置):截取字符串中的一部分locate(被查找的字符串,列名):查找再该字符串中某个字符的位置MySQL字段中去掉括号eg:select*from(selec
    1071天前 MySQL 0
  • redis使用lettuce启动导致内存泄漏错误怎么解决 正版软件
    redis使用lettuce启动导致内存泄漏错误怎么解决
    redis使用lettuce出现LEAK:hashedwheelTimer.release()wasnotcalledbeforeit'sgarbage-collected.Enableadvancedleak内存泄漏。其实是内存不够大导致。找到eclispe中window->preferences->Java->InstalledJRE,点击右侧的Edit按钮,在编辑界面中的“DefaultVMArguments”选项中,填入如下值即可。-Xms64m-Xmx128m内存调的足够大可解决。另一种
    1071天前 redis lettuce 0
  • Java Servlet程序实例分析 正版软件
    Java Servlet程序实例分析
    Servlet运行在服务端(tomcat)的java程序。是sun公司的一套规范,就是动态资源。Servlet作用用来接收客户端的请求,处理请求,响应给浏览器的动态资源。但Servlet本质就是java代码,通过java的API动态的向客户端传输数据内容。Servlet与普通的java程序的区别:1,必须实现Servlet接口2,必须在servlet容器(tomcat服务器)中运行3,servlet程序可以接收用户请求的参数以及向浏览器输出数据。Servlet接口并不是JDK中的接口,所以我们需要导入ja
    1071天前 Java servlet 0
  • Java8中Clock时钟类怎么用 正版软件
    Java8中Clock时钟类怎么用
    Java8的Clock时钟类Java8增加了一个Clock时钟类用于获取当时的时间戳,或当前时区下的日期时间信息。以前用到System.currentTimeInMillis()和TimeZone.getDefault()的地方都可用Clock替换。packagecom.shxt.demo02;importjava.time.Clock;publicclassDemo10{publicstaticvoidmain(String[]args){//Returnsthecurrenttimebasedonyo
    1071天前 Java clock java8 0